The Rise of Precision Finding and UWB Technology

Apple’s integration of its second-generation Ultra Wideband chip across its product line – from iPhones to Apple Watches – is a strategic move that solidifies UWB as the leading technology for short-range, high-accuracy location tracking. Unlike Bluetooth, which relies on signal strength, UWB measures the time it takes for a signal to travel, providing much more precise positioning. This is why Precision Finding, guiding users with haptic, visual, and audio cues, is so effective. The 50% increase in range compared to the previous AirTag generation is a significant leap forward. Samsung is also heavily investing in UWB, indicating a broader industry trend. Expect to see UWB become a standard feature in smartphones and other devices in the coming years, enabling a new wave of location-aware applications.

Share Item Location: A Game Changer for Travel and Logistics

Apple’s partnership with over 50 airlines to implement Share Item Location is arguably the most innovative aspect of the new AirTag. The success reported by SITA – a 26% reduction in baggage delays and a 90% reduction in “truly lost” luggage – is compelling evidence of its effectiveness. This feature addresses a major pain point for travelers and demonstrates the power of collaborative tracking. Beyond airlines, we can anticipate similar integrations with other logistics providers, rental car companies, and even delivery services. The key is secure data sharing and user privacy, which Apple has prioritized with its end-to-end encryption and time-limited access controls.

Security and Privacy: The Ongoing Balancing Act

The debate surrounding item trackers and potential misuse for stalking remains a critical concern. Apple has proactively addressed these concerns with features like cross-platform alerts and frequently changing Bluetooth identifiers. However, ongoing vigilance is essential. Future iterations of AirTag and similar devices will likely incorporate even more sophisticated anti-stalking measures, potentially leveraging AI to detect suspicious tracking patterns. Legislative efforts to regulate the use of item trackers and protect individual privacy are also expected to gain momentum.

Environmental Considerations and Sustainable Tracking

Apple’s commitment to environmental responsibility, with the new AirTag utilizing 85% recycled plastic and 100% recycled rare earth elements, sets a positive example for the industry. Consumers are increasingly demanding sustainable products, and manufacturers will need to prioritize eco-friendly materials and manufacturing processes. The longevity of tracking devices is also crucial. A durable, long-lasting tracker reduces electronic waste and minimizes the need for frequent replacements.

FAQ

  • What is Ultra Wideband (UWB)? UWB is a short-range, high-accuracy wireless communication technology that measures the time it takes for a signal to travel, providing precise location data.
  • Is AirTag only compatible with iPhones? Yes, AirTag requires an iPhone with iOS 26 or later, or an iPad with iPadOS 26 or later.
  • How does Share Item Location protect my privacy? Share Item Location uses end-to-end encryption and grants access only to authorized personnel for a limited time.
  • Can AirTag be used to track people? AirTag is designed for tracking objects, not people. Apple has implemented features to deter unwanted tracking.
  • What is the battery life of the new AirTag? The new AirTag has a battery life of up to one year, depending on usage.
